After difficult summer, Wayne Ellington hopes to stick with Lakers


"It's been a rough summer for me, but I worked my [rear] off," said at the Lakers' annual media day on Monday. The Lakers signed Ellington to a non-guaranteed contract. If he can stick with the team past training camp, $315,656 of his salary will guaranteed on Nov. 15, and $581,692 of his contract locks in if he's on the roster as of Dec. 1.
